Essence has grown up in a perfect life, perfect parents, perfect friends, perfect town. She only now realizes that she might be the only thing out of place in it. When she travels to Britain with her friends, the game starts to change. Essence feels less chained, almost like she has left the chore of her perfectness. Taking risks, she starts to enjoy herself, truly finding out the meaning of life. What starts off as a few consequences turns into a horrific bad luck. Not only does she not hold that perfectness anymore, but now her life is ruled with darkness and messups wherever she goes. As Essence travels to find out what really happened so many years ago; can she find out that only love and friendship can make one truly happy? COVER IS NOT MINE.
